MVP Health Care Partners with Rochester Regional Health to Establish Innovative Patient Engagement and Support Program

By embedding a registered nurse in the hospital, MVP aims to collaborate on enhanced transitions from the hospital to improve the customer experience

Rochester, NY — August 8, 2023 — MVP Health Care (MVP) today announced a partnership with Rochester Regional Health to launch a care management and engagement program that will better serve customers in the hospital and in their transition post discharge. Through the program, MVP registered nurses (RN) will work on-site at Rochester Regional Health as care managers, providing wrap-around health care services to MVP customers during their hospital stay and post-discharge. Embedding care managers in the hospital provides customers with additional opportunities to ask questions and more deeply understand their care plan and benefit options, ensuring they have the resources needed to achieve the best health outcomes.


The services offered by on-site care managers will include:

  • Facilitating post-discharge follow up with appropriate providers.
  • Ensuring that customers understand their MVP benefits.
  • Additional support with regard to medication management.
  • Evaluating social determinants of health impacts to each customer and their care plan, such as coordinating transportation assistance and meal delivery options.
  • Providing appropriate referrals and support for customers that may not have a relationship with specific doctors for follow-up.

Enhancing customer engagement is key to improving clinical outcomes, customer experience and quality performance. A recent study from the Joint Commission Journal on Quality and Patient Safety found that only between 50 and 60 percent of patients remember key information from recent inpatient stays, and only 50 percent correctly recalled post-discharge treatment plans.

About Rochester Regional Health

Rochester Regional Health is an integrated health services organization serving the people of Western New York, the Finger Lakes, St. Lawrence County, and beyond. The system includes nine hospitals; primary and specialty practices, rehabilitation centers, ambulatory campuses and immediate care facilities; innovative senior services, facilities and independent housing; a wide range of behavioral health services; and Rochester Regional Health Laboratories and ACM Global Laboratories, a global leader in patient and clinical trials.
